The Conversion Factor: Bridging the Gap Between Miles and Kilometers

The key to converting miles to kilometers is the conversion factor. One mile is approximately equal to 1.60934 kilometers. This factor represents the ratio between the two units. Because of this, to convert miles to kilometers, you simply multiply the number of miles by this conversion factor.

Calculating 108 Miles in Kilometers

To find out how many kilometers are equivalent to 108 miles, we use the conversion factor:

108 miles * 1.60934 kilometers/mile ≈ 173.81 kilometers

So, 108 miles is approximately equal to 173.81 kilometers.

Detailed Step-by-Step Calculation

For those who prefer a more step-by-step approach, here's a breakdown of the calculation:

  1. Identify the conversion factor: 1 mile ≈ 1.60934 kilometers
  2. Write down the given value: 108 miles
  3. Set up the conversion: 108 miles * (1.60934 kilometers / 1 mile)
  4. Cancel out the units: The "miles" unit cancels out, leaving only "kilometers".
  5. Perform the multiplication: 108 * 1.60934 = 173.81 kilometers (approximately)

The conversion from miles to kilometers highlights the fundamental difference between the imperial and metric systems. On the flip side, the metric system, based on powers of 10, is inherently simpler for calculations and conversions. The imperial system, on the other hand, employs a less intuitive system of units, making conversions more complex.

The metric system's simplicity stems from its consistent use of prefixes (like kilo, centi, milli) to denote multiples or fractions of the base unit. This systematic approach simplifies conversions and calculations significantly. To give you an idea, converting kilometers to meters is straightforward; you simply multiply by 1000 (since 1 kilometer = 1000 meters). In contrast, converting miles to yards or feet involves less straightforward factors.
